These “carry-overs” may contain corruption that is causing your problem.Īfter you do the uninstall, boot the computer and check to see if you still have any copies of Office Pro Plus (I suspect you will). and it also leaves configuration Registry entries. It leaves configuration files like NORMAL.DOTM and other templates etc. The Normal uninstall is designed with the assumption that you will be re-installing Office. Method 1 in this tip does a more thorough job that the "normal" uninstall via Programs and Features (aka Method 2 in the tip).
